    Michael C. Hall Hopes Upcoming Dexter Revival Will Atone for 'Extremely Dissatisfying' Series Finale

    Michael C. Hall agreed to reprise his titular Dexter role for Showtime's upcoming revival in part because of the sour note the original series ended on seven years ago.     The queen and 'The Crown': Clever and emotional

    Historical drama doesn’t get more clever or well-executed than in The Crown, which is now streaming its second season on Netflix. The series starring Claire Foy as Queen Elizabeth, created and largely written by Peter Morgan, takes another 10 episodes to chronicle a big batch of history, this time commencing during the 1950s.     Sundance Report: Inside Rebecca Hall's Tragic Performance as a Suicidal Reporter in 'Christine'

    Rebecca Hall so thoroughly inhabits the role of late Florida newscaster Christine Chubbuck in the movie Christine that, when she spoke with Yahoo Movies about the Sundance Film Festival drama on Sunday, the sound of her natural British accent qualified as a genuine shock. Hall delivers a bold, transformed performance in director Antonio Campos’ intense and ultimately tragic second feature, offering up a sympathetic portrait of a very enigmatic (and unknowable) figure.
